#1ceb84 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#1ceb84 is composed of 11% red, 92.2% green and 51.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 88.1% cyan, 0% magenta, 43.8% yellow and 7.8% black. It has a hue angle of 150.1 degrees, a saturation of 83.8% and a lightness of 51.6%. #1ceb84 color hex could be obtained by blending #38ffff with #00d709. Closest websafe color is: #33ff99.

#1ceb84 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#1ceb84 has RGB values of R:28, G:235, B:132 and CMYK values of C:0.88, M:0, Y:0.44, K:0.08. Its decimal value is 1895300.

Shades and Tints of #1ceb84
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010704 is the darkest color, while #f4fef9 is the lightest one.
